Verdikoussa ( Greek: Βερδικούσσα, [2] Greek pronunciation: [veɾði'kusa]) is a village, a community and a municipal unit of the Elassona municipality. [3] Before the 2011 local government it was an independent community. [2] [3] The community of Verdikoussa covers an area of 101.267 km2. [4]

The population of Verdikoussa is occupied in animal husbandry, agriculture ( tobacco and organic vegetables) and lumbering. [6]
Year | Pop. | ±% |
---|---|---|
2001 [4] | 2,126 | — |
2011 [5] | 2,254 | +6.0% |
2021 [1] | 1,350 | −40.1% |
